Pros

I've been here for three years working in their Paris offices and I've been enjoying it lot. It's very stimulating. I met lots of smart and nice people. I seized the opportunity to self-educate myself on databases with the help of the best specialists there are.

Cons

Lack of formal training opportunities: there's no one in charge of training in this company and I have to pay for my own language classes.

Pros

Giving great responsibilities to the employees very quickly, amazing colleagues, very cool workplace, interesting product and technology. The company is human sized which is enabling incredible relationships with colleague, during and after the workday.

Cons

Not best in-class salary, huge treatment difference between core functions like r&d and support functions like finance or IT. Criteo can do better in this area.

Pros

The company treats employees well. It is possible to plan a career path. Great location of the office in Barcelona, nest to the port.

Cons

Criteo is a big international company, with established bureaucratic procedures. It is not the agile start up anymore. Of course this has its pros and cons.
